Understanding Emissions Trading System Regulations in Climate Policy Law

Emissions trading system regulations are legal standards established to regulate the control and reduction of greenhouse gas emissions through market-based mechanisms. These regulations set the framework for how emissions allowances are allocated, traded, and monitored within specific jurisdictions. Their primary aim is to facilitate cost-effective emissions reductions while encouraging innovation and industry compliance.

The core principle of these regulations involves creating a cap on total emissions, which is then divided into allowances or permits. Entities covered by the system must hold enough allowances to cover their emissions, incentivizing reductions if they emit less than their allowances. Trading allows market participants to buy or sell allowances, fostering flexibility and economic efficiency.

Legal frameworks for emissions trading system regulations outline the procedures for permit allocation, compliance obligations, enforcement mechanisms, and penalties for violations. These frameworks are crafted within the broader context of climate policy law, ensuring consistency with national and international commitments while providing clear operational rules for stakeholders involved in emissions trading.

Key Challenges in Developing Emissions Trading System Regulations

Developing emissions trading system regulations presents several significant challenges. One primary obstacle involves balancing environmental goals with economic competitiveness. Regulations must effectively reduce emissions without disproportionally burdening industries or risking economic downturns.

Another challenge lies in establishing accurate emission baselines and caps. These metrics are critical for fair trading and require reliable data collection, which can be complex due to varying measurement standards and reporting practices across jurisdictions. Inconsistent data hampers enforcement and transparency.

Legal uncertainties also complicate the development process. Evolving international agreements and national policies can create conflicting obligations, requiring continuous legal revisions. Ensuring legislation remains flexible yet predictable is difficult, particularly given the rapid pace of technological change.

Finally, stakeholder engagement remains a persistent challenge. Diverse interests within government, industry, and civil society can lead to disagreements over regulation scope and implementation. Securing consensus is essential yet often difficult due to competing priorities and concerns about economic impacts.

Case Studies of Emissions Trading System Regulations in Practice

European Union Emissions Trading System (EU ETS) is the world’s largest and most established emissions trading system. It was launched in 2005 and covers numerous sectors including power generation, industry, and aviation. The EU ETS has significantly influenced the development of emissions trading regulations globally.

The EU ETS operates on a cap-and-trade basis, setting a maximum limit on emissions and issuing allowances accordingly. Companies must surrender allowances equal to their emissions, creating a strong incentive to reduce carbon output. The system’s compliance mechanisms and strict monitoring have set a benchmark for other jurisdictions.

California’s Cap-and-Trade Program, initiated in 2013, exemplifies a successful regional emissions trading system. It applies to industries, electricity, and transportation sectors within California, integrating seamlessly with federal policies. Its market-driven approach encourages emission reductions through auctioned allowances and transparency.

Both case studies highlight the importance of legal frameworks that support flexibility, enforceability, and international cooperation. These emissions trading regulations serve as models for jurisdictions aiming to balance economic growth with climate commitments.

European Union Emissions Trading System

The European Union Emissions Trading System (EU ETS) is a pioneering market-based regulation designed to limit greenhouse gas emissions from key sectors such as power generation and industrial processes. It operates on a cap-and-trade principle, which sets a maximum emission limit and allows trading of allowances among participants.

Key features of the EU ETS include:

  1. Emission Allowances: Each allowance permits the holder to emit one tonne of CO₂.
  2. Allocation Methods: Allowances are typically distributed through free allocation, auctioning, or a combination of both.
  3. Coverage: The system encompasses thousands of installations across member states, ensuring broad sectoral coverage.

The EU continuously refines its emissions trading regulations to enhance effectiveness. This includes tightening the cap over time, introducing stricter compliance standards, and aligning policies with global climate commitments. The system serves as a model for emissions trading regulations worldwide.

California Cap-and-Trade Program

The California Cap-and-Trade Program is a regulatory framework designed to limit greenhouse gas emissions while promoting economic growth. It establishes a declining cap on emissions from covered sectors, encouraging emission reductions over time. Key elements include a comprehensive allowance system and market-based trading.

Participants in the program include electric utilities, industrial entities, and fuel distributors. They are allocated or purchase allowances, which represent the right to emit a specific amount of greenhouse gases. The total allowances are limited by the cap, which decreases annually to drive emissions downward.

The program employs a robust compliance and enforcement mechanism to ensure adherence. Non-compliance results in penalties, and allowances must be surrendered annually, fostering accountability. Transparency is maintained through regular reporting and public access to trading data.

Key challenges include balancing economic impacts with environmental goals and preventing market manipulation. Despite these issues, California’s program significantly contributes to the state’s climate policy law by integrating emissions trading regulations into broader environmental strategies.
